Reasons to consider the AMD FX-8370E

  • CPU is newer: launch date 2 month(s) later
  • Processor is unlocked, an unlocked multiplier allows for easier overclocking
  • 6 more cores, run more applications at once: 8 vs 2
  • 6 more threads: 8 vs 2
  • Around 34% higher clock speed: 4.3 GHz vs 3.2 GHz
  • 16x more L2 cache, more data can be stored in the L2 cache for quick access later
  • 2.6x better performance in PassMark - CPU mark: 5319 vs 2010
  • 4.4x better performance in Geekbench 4 - Single Core: 2859 vs 654
  • 9.9x better performance in Geekbench 4 - Multi-Core: 11715 vs 1182
  • Around 69% better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- Face Detection (mPixels/s): 9.383 vs 5.545

Reasons to consider the Intel Pentium G3250

  • Around 1% higher maximum core temperature: 72°C vs 71 °C
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running processor: 22 nm vs 32 nm
  • Around 79% lower typical power consumption: 53 Watt vs 95 Watt
  • Around 23% better performance in PassMark - Single thread mark: 1809 vs 1466
